The Electric Playground Coming To SCI FI Dec 1!



Time to get excited!

One of the most respected entertainment shows on the planet is coming Down Under. Victor Lucas and the crew from The Electric Playground will be beaming every day on SCI FI and online, for Australian viewers.

We've had a chat with Victor, who is creator, producer and presenter of the show, and he's even more excited than us.

If you don't know The Electric Playground, it's a daily half hour show about what's cool to people like you and me. With a strong focus on games and gaming culture, it also takes in a broader scope of the Geekiverse, covering Sci Fi Movies, TV shows, music and comic books.

The great thing about The Electric Playground is that the presenters aren't just mouthpieces - they create their own segments, and deliver them from all over North America. Victor Lucas and Briana McIvor co-present in Vancouver, Jose 'Fubar' Sanchez loves comics in San Francisco, Miri Jedeikin covers the movie biz from Los Angeles and Shaun Hatton goes all gamey from Toronto. They really do know their stuff, and have the kind of access we here in SCI FI PI-land can only dream about.

The show has been a Canadian staple since 1997, and will soon bring its experience and knowledge every day to SCI FI Australia, in the prime time of 8pm. If you want to catch up with everything that's going on everywhere, every day, you'll be able to tune in to The Electric Playground on air, online in Spectrum, and on your phone.
